    def delete_metric_descriptor(
        self,
        name,
        retry=google.api_core.gapic_v1.method.DEFAULT,
        timeout=google.api_core.gapic_v1.method.DEFAULT,
        metadata=None,
    ):
        """
        Deletes a metric descriptor. Only user-created `custom
        metrics <https://cloud.google.com/monitoring/custom-metrics>`__ can be
        deleted.

        Example:
            >>> from google.cloud import monitoring_v3
            >>>
            >>> client = monitoring_v3.MetricServiceClient()
            >>>
            >>> name = client.metric_descriptor_path('[PROJECT]', '[METRIC_DESCRIPTOR]')
            >>>
            >>> client.delete_metric_descriptor(name)

        Args:
            name (str): The metric descriptor on which to execute the request. The format is
                ``"projects/{project_id_or_number}/metricDescriptors/{metric_id}"``. An
                example of ``{metric_id}`` is:
                ``"custom.googleapis.com/my_test_metric"``.
            retry (Optional[google.api_core.retry.Retry]):  A retry object used
                to retry requests. If ``None`` is specified, requests will not
                be retried.
            timeout (Optional[float]): The amount of time, in seconds, to wait
                for the request to complete. Note that if ``retry`` is
                specified, the timeout applies to each individual attempt.
            metadata (Optional[Sequence[Tuple[str, str]]]): Additional metadata
                that is provided to the method.

        Raises:
            google.api_core.exceptions.GoogleAPICallError: If the request
                    failed for any reason.
            google.api_core.exceptions.RetryError: If the request failed due
                    to a retryable error and retry attempts failed.
            ValueError: If the parameters are invalid.
        """
        if metadata is None:
            metadata = []
        metadata = list(metadata)
        # Wrap the transport method to add retry and timeout logic.
        if "delete_metric_descriptor" not in self._inner_api_calls:
            self._inner_api_calls[
                "delete_metric_descriptor"
            ] = google.api_core.gapic_v1.method.wrap_method(
                self.transport.delete_metric_descriptor,
                default_retry=self._method_configs["DeleteMetricDescriptor"].retry,
                default_timeout=self._method_configs["DeleteMetricDescriptor"].timeout,
                client_info=self._client_info,
            )

        request = metric_service_pb2.DeleteMetricDescriptorRequest(name=name)
        self._inner_api_calls["delete_metric_descriptor"](
            request, retry=retry, timeout=timeout, metadata=metadata
        )

    def test_delete_metric_descriptor(self):
        channel = ChannelStub()
        client = monitoring_v3.MetricServiceClient(channel=channel)

        # Setup Request
        name = client.metric_descriptor_path('[PROJECT]',
                                             '[METRIC_DESCRIPTOR]')

        client.delete_metric_descriptor(name)

        assert len(channel.requests) == 1
        expected_request = metric_service_pb2.DeleteMetricDescriptorRequest(
            name=name)
        actual_request = channel.requests[0][1]
        assert expected_request == actual_request
